Alessandro,<br><br>Refer to <a href="http://www.gdal.org/gdal_tutorial.html">http://www.gdal.org/gdal_tutorial.html</a> for a tutorial on how to do handle raster data with GDAL.<br>Look closely at GDALCreateCopy() or GDALDriver::CreateCopy().<br>
<br><div class="gmail_quote">On Tue, Jun 22, 2010 at 1:33 PM, canduc17 <span dir="ltr">&lt;<a href="mailto:candini@meeo.it">candini@meeo.it</a>&gt;</span> wrote:<br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
<br>
I have an input dataset like this:Driver: GTiff/GeoTIFF<br>
Files: aot.2007154.0950.geo.tif<br>
Size is 5657, 2287<br>
Coordinate System is:<br>
GEOGCS[&quot;WGS 84&quot;,<br>
    DATUM[&quot;WGS_1984&quot;,<br>
        SPHEROID[&quot;WGS 84&quot;,6378137,298.2572235630016,<br>
            AUTHORITY[&quot;EPSG&quot;,&quot;7030&quot;]],<br>
        AUTHORITY[&quot;EPSG&quot;,&quot;6326&quot;]],<br>
    PRIMEM[&quot;Greenwich&quot;,0],<br>
    UNIT[&quot;degree&quot;,0.0174532925199433],<br>
    AUTHORITY[&quot;EPSG&quot;,&quot;4326&quot;]]<br>
Origin = (0.452892184257507,72.917350769042969)<br>
Pixel Size = (0.010000000000000,-0.010000000000000)<br>
Metadata:<br>
  AREA_OR_POINT=Area<br>
Image Structure Metadata:<br>
  COMPRESSION=LZW<br>
  INTERLEAVE=BAND<br>
Corner Coordinates:<br>
Upper Left  (   0.4528922,  72.9173508) (  0d27&#39;10.41&quot;E, 72d55&#39;2.46&quot;N)<br>
Lower Left  (   0.4528922,  50.0473508) (  0d27&#39;10.41&quot;E, 50d 2&#39;50.46&quot;N)<br>
Upper Right (  57.0228922,  72.9173508) ( 57d 1&#39;22.41&quot;E, 72d55&#39;2.46&quot;N)<br>
Lower Right (  57.0228922,  50.0473508) ( 57d 1&#39;22.41&quot;E, 50d 2&#39;50.46&quot;N)<br>
Center      (  28.7378922,  61.4823508) ( 28d44&#39;16.41&quot;E, 61d28&#39;56.46&quot;N)<br>
Band 1 Block=5657x1 Type=Float32, ColorInterp=Gray</blockquote><div> </div><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">and I want to copy<br>

coordinate system, origin, pixel size and corner coordinates from this<br>
dataset to the output one.<br>
How to do this in C++?<br>
Thanks in advance.<br>
<font color="#888888">--<br>
View this message in context: <a href="http://osgeo-org.1803224.n2.nabble.com/Copy-coordinate-system-and-corner-coordinates-tp5207721p5207721.html" target="_blank">http://osgeo-org.1803224.n2.nabble.com/Copy-coordinate-system-and-corner-coordinates-tp5207721p5207721.html</a><br>

Sent from the GDAL - Dev mailing list archive at Nabble.com.<br>
_______________________________________________<br>
gdal-dev mailing list<br>
<a href="mailto:gdal-dev@lists.osgeo.org">gdal-dev@lists.osgeo.org</a><br>
<a href="http://lists.osgeo.org/mailman/listinfo/gdal-dev" target="_blank">http://lists.osgeo.org/mailman/listinfo/gdal-dev</a><br>
</font></blockquote></div><br><br clear="all"><br>-- <br>Best regards,<br>Chaitanya kumar CH.<br>/tʃaɪθənjə/ /kʊmɑr/ <br>+91-9494447584<br>17.2416N 80.1426E<br>